McAllen, Texas, offers promising career opportunities for aspiring electricians, with an 11% projected job growth nationwide through 2033 and an average salary of $44,820 per year. Attending a local electrician school is a key step toward launching a rewarding career in this high-demand field.
Key Points
Electricians are skilled professionals responsible for installing, maintaining, and repairing electrical systems. Their work ensures electrical safety and efficiency in various settings.
While fully online programs aren’t available, some hybrid programs combine online coursework with in-person labs. Additionally, scholarships and financial aid may help reduce costs.
To become licensed, candidates must pass the Texas Electrical Exam, which tests knowledge of the National Electrical Code and electrical safety standards.
